Handover: Pellock KV, bloom filter tier. Filter sits in front of the Varnholt store to cut negative lookups. False-positive rate tuned at 0.4%; rebuilds nightly from the keyspace snapshot. No auth between filter and store — same pod, loopback only. Review the rebuild job's write scope before sign-off; it has broader access than it needs. Taking over: Dren Masek. Current service configuration follows below.

config for tagep-yajef:
ulawyn:
  log_level: error
  metrics_host: metrics.ulawyn.lumiclabs.internal
  pin: 0564
  pool_size: 32

## Sensor drift: what to do at 3am

If the GrowLoop controller starts reporting humidity swings that don't match the backup probes in the Fernwick greenhouse, it's almost always sensor drift, not an actual climate event. Don't panic and don't touch the vents manually. First, restart the calibration daemon and give it ten minutes to re-baseline. If readings still disagree by more than 5%, flip the controller into safe mode. The safe-mode thresholds it will use are these.

config for yahap-bajof:
[istix]
host = istix.qorvelsys.internal
user = istix_svc
database = istix_prod

# --- Migration settings (Copperlane support notes) ---
# Zero-downtime migrations: expand-then-contract only.
# New columns ship nullable; backfill runs via the drift
# worker; contraction waits one full release cycle.
# Support: never run migrations manually during business
# hours. If a customer reports stuck writes, check the
# drift worker first. It connects using the string below.

primary connection of yagep-kahip = redis://giliel_svc:zYiKsLL2PLpfPL@db-348f.xolmarsys.corp:5432/fenwyn

## What this does

Adds `shrinkbatch`, a CLI for batch image resizing in the Pendrell toolkit. Support team: point customers here when they hit upload-size rejections. It walks a directory, resizes to target dimensions, preserves EXIF, and skips files already within bounds. Failures are logged per-file, never fatal. Concurrency and size caps are configurable via flags but ship with safe defaults. Those defaults are defined by the constants below.

tuning constants:
BUDGETS = {
    "druath": 240,
    "lamwyn": 180,
    "silael": 275,
}